The Heath Quartet formed in 2002 at the Royal Northern College of Music in Manchester, England. Among their many honors since: a Borletti-Buitoni Special Ensemble Scholarship, Ensemble Prize at the Festspiele Mecklenburg-Vorpommern, a Gramophone Chamber Award for their recording of the complete string quartets of Sir Michael Tippett, and the prestigious Royal Philharmonic Society’s Young Artists Award. They perform regularly across the U.S., at the Mecklenberg Vorpommern summer festival, and at London’s Wigmore Hall.
